MAX1340/MAX1342/MAX1346/MAX1348:多功能12位ADC與DAC芯片深度解析
在電子設計領域,模數轉換器(ADC)和數模轉換器(DAC)是非常關鍵的器件,它們在信號處理、數據采集等眾多應用中發(fā)揮著重要作用。今天我們就來詳細探討一下MAXIM公司的MAX1340/MAX1342/MAX1346/MAX1348這一系列集成了12位多通道ADC和四通道12位DAC的芯片。
文件下載:MAX1340BETX+.pdf
一、芯片概述
MAX1340/MAX1342/MAX1346/MAX1348將多通道12位ADC和四通道12位DAC集成在單一芯片中,同時還配備了溫度傳感器和可配置的通用輸入輸出端口(GPIOs),采用25MHz SPI?-/QSPI?-/MICROWIRE?兼容的串行接口。ADC有4通道或8通道版本可供選擇,四個DAC輸出在2.0μs內穩(wěn)定,ADC的轉換速率可達225ksps。
1. 內部參考
所有器件都包含一個內部參考(4.096V),為ADC和DAC提供了穩(wěn)定、低噪聲的參考電壓。同時,ADC和DAC支持可編程參考模式,用戶可以選擇使用內部參考、外部參考或兩者結合。
2. 低功耗特性
這些芯片在不同工作模式下的功耗表現出色。在225ksps吞吐量時功耗為2.5mA,1ksps吞吐量時僅為22μA,關機模式下功耗低于0.2μA。
3. 封裝與工作溫度范圍
芯片采用36引腳薄型QFN封裝,工作溫度范圍為 -40°C 至 +85°C,能適應較為惡劣的工作環(huán)境。
二、應用領域
1. 閉環(huán)控制
適用于光組件和基站的閉環(huán)控制,其低毛刺能量(4nV?s)和低數字饋通(0.5nV?s)的特性,使其能夠實現對快速響應閉環(huán)系統的精確數字控制。
2. 系統監(jiān)控與控制
可用于系統的監(jiān)控和控制,實時采集和處理各種模擬信號。
3. 數據采集系統
在數據采集系統中,能夠高效地將模擬信號轉換為數字信號,滿足數據采集的需求。
三、芯片特性
1. ADC特性
- 高分辨率與高精度:12位分辨率,積分非線性(INL)和微分非線性(DNL)均為±0.5 LSB,保證了轉換的精度。
- 多通道選擇:MAX1340/MAX1342提供8個單端通道或4個差分通道;MAX1346/MAX1348提供4個單端通道或2個差分通道,支持單極性或雙極性輸入。
- 動態(tài)性能出色:在10kHz正弦波輸入、225ksps采樣率下,信號噪聲失真比(SINAD)可達70dB,總諧波失真(THD)為 -76dBc,無雜散動態(tài)范圍(SFDR)為72dBc。
2. DAC特性
- 快速穩(wěn)定:12位四通道DAC,輸出在2μs內穩(wěn)定。
- 低毛刺能量:超低毛刺能量(4nV?s),減少了信號干擾。
- 高精度:積分非線性(INL)為±0.5 LSB,保證了輸出的精度。
3. 其他特性
- 內部溫度傳感器:內部±1°C精確溫度傳感器,可實時監(jiān)測芯片溫度。
- FIFO功能:片上FIFO能夠存儲16個ADC轉換結果和一個溫度結果,方便數據的處理和存儲。
- 通道掃描與數據平均:支持片上通道掃描模式和內部數據平均功能,提高了數據采集的效率和準確性。
四、電氣特性
1. ADC電氣特性
| 參數 | 符號 | 條件 | 最小值 | 典型值 | 最大值 | 單位 |
|---|---|---|---|---|---|---|
| 分辨率 | - | - | 12 | - | - | Bits |
| 積分非線性 | INL | - | - | ±0.5 | ±1.0 | LSB |
| 微分非線性 | DNL | - | - | ±0.5 | ±1.0 | LSB |
| 偏移誤差 | - | - | - | ±0.5 | ±4.0 | LSB |
| 增益誤差 | - | (注2) | - | ±0.5 | ±4.0 | LSB |
| 增益溫度系數 | - | - | - | ±0.8 | - | ppm/°C |
| 通道間偏移 | - | - | - | ±0.1 | - | LSB |
2. DAC電氣特性
| 參數 | 符號 | 條件 | 最小值 | 典型值 | 最大值 | 單位 |
|---|---|---|---|---|---|---|
| 分辨率 | - | - | 12 | - | - | Bits |
| 積分非線性 | INL | - | - | ±0.5 | ±4 | LSB |
| 微分非線性 | DNL | 保證單調 | - | - | ±1.0 | LSB |
| 偏移誤差 | V OS | (注8) | - | ±3 | ±10 | mV |
| 偏移誤差漂移 | - | - | - | ±10 | - | ppm of FS/°C |
| 增益誤差 | GE | (注8) | - | ±5 | ±10 | LSB |
| 增益溫度系數 | - | - | - | ±8 | - | ppm of FS/°C |
五、引腳描述
芯片的引腳功能豐富,不同引腳承擔著不同的功能,以下是部分重要引腳的介紹:
1. 電源引腳
- DVDD:數字正電源輸入,需通過0.1μF電容旁路到DGND。
- AVDD:模擬正電源輸入,需通過0.1μF電容旁路到AGND。
- DGND:數字地,需連接到AGND。
- AGND:模擬地。
2. 通信引腳
- SCLK:串行時鐘輸入,用于時鐘數據的輸入和輸出。
- DIN:串行數據輸入,數據在SCLK的下降沿鎖存到串行接口。
- DOUT:串行數據輸出,在不同時鐘模式下,數據在SCLK的下降沿或上升沿輸出。
- CS:片選輸入,低電平有效,使能串行接口。
3. 轉換與控制引腳
- EOC:轉換結束輸出,低電平有效,EOC下降沿后數據有效。
- LDAC:低電平有效,用于更新DAC輸出。
- CNVST:轉換啟動輸入,低電平有效,用于啟動轉換。
4. 模擬輸入引腳
- AIN0 - AIN7:模擬輸入引腳,可接受單端或差分輸入信號。
5. 參考引腳
- REF1:參考電壓輸入,可使用內部參考(4.096V)或外部參考。
- REF2:參考電壓輸入或模擬輸入通道6,在ADC外部差分參考模式中作為負參考。
6. GPIO引腳
MAX1342/MAX1348提供四個GPIOs,可配置為輸入或輸出。
六、SPI兼容串行接口
MAX1340/MAX1342/MAX1346/MAX1348的串行接口與SPI和MICROWIRE設備兼容。在使用SPI時,需要確保SPI總線主設備(通常是微控制器)工作在主模式,生成串行時鐘信號。SCLK頻率應選擇25MHz或更低,并設置時鐘極性(CPOL)和相位(CPHA)與微控制器控制寄存器中的值相同。
1. 數據傳輸
通過CS的高低電平轉換來控制數據輸入操作。串行通信總是從DIN加載一個8位命令字節(jié)開始,后續(xù)的數據字節(jié)在SCLK的下降沿從DIN時鐘到串行接口。命令字節(jié)的內容決定了SPI端口應接收的位數以及數據的目標(ADC、DAC或GPIOs)。
2. 寄存器操作
- 轉換寄存器:控制ADC通道選擇、ADC掃描模式和溫度測量請求。
- 設置寄存器:控制時鐘模式、參考和單極性/雙極性ADC配置。
- ADC平均寄存器:特定于ADC,用于實現數據平均功能。
- DAC接口寄存器:用于選擇DAC并寫入數據。
- GPIO寄存器:用于配置和讀寫GPIOs(僅適用于MAX1342/MAX1348)。
七、總結
MAX1340/MAX1342/MAX1346/MAX1348系列芯片以其高性能、低功耗和豐富的功能,為電子工程師在數據采集、信號處理和系統控制等領域提供了一個優(yōu)秀的解決方案。在實際應用中,工程師可以根據具體需求選擇合適的芯片型號,并合理配置寄存器,以實現最佳的性能。同時,在設計過程中要注意電源旁路、引腳連接等細節(jié),確保芯片的正常工作。大家在使用這些芯片時,有沒有遇到過什么問題或者有什么獨特的應用經驗呢?歡迎在評論區(qū)分享。
-
電子設計
+關注
關注
42文章
2667瀏覽量
49908
發(fā)布評論請先 登錄
MAX1340/MAX1342/MAX1346/MAX1348:多功能12位ADC與DAC芯片深度解析
評論